BackgroundThe terminally ill person’s autonomy and control are important in preserving the quality of life in situations of unbearable suffering. Voluntary stopping of eating and drinking (VSED) at the end of life has been discussed over the past 20 years as one possibility of hastening death. This article presents a ‘systematic search and review’ of published literature concerned with VSED as an option of hastening death at the end of life by adults with decision-making capacity.MethodsElectronic databases PubMed, EBSCOhost CINAHL and Ovid PsycINFO were systematically searched. Additionally, Google Scholar was searched and reference lists of included articles were checked. Data of the included studies were extracted, evaluated and summarized in narrative form.ResultsOverall, out of 29 eligible articles 16 were included in this review. VSED can be defined as an action by a competent, capacitated person, who voluntarily and deliberately chooses to stop eating and drinking with the primary intention of hastening death because of the persistence of unacceptable suffering. An estimated number of deaths by VSED was only provided by one study from the Netherlands, which revealed a prevalence of 2.1% of deaths/year (on average 2800 deaths/year). Main reasons for patients hastening death by VSED are: readiness to die, life perceived as being pointless, poor quality of life, a desire to die at home, and the wish to control the circumstances of death. The physiological processes occurring during VSED and the supportive care interventions could not be identified through our search.ConclusionsThe included articles provide marginal insight into VSED for hastening death. Research is needed in the field of theory-building and should be based on qualitative studies from different perspectives (patient, family members, and healthcare workers) about physiological processes during VSED, and about the prevalence and magnitude of VSED. Based on these findings supportive care interventions for patients and family members and recommendations for healthcare staff should be developed and tested.
To compare the prediction of hip fracture risk of several bone ultrasounds (QUS), 7062 Swiss women ≥70 years of age were measured with three QUSs (two of the heel, one of the phalanges). Heel QUSs were both predictive of hip fracture risk, whereas the phalanges QUS was not.Introduction: As the number of hip fracture is expected to increase during these next decades, it is important to develop strategies to detect subjects at risk. Quantitative bone ultrasound (QUS), an ionizing radiation-free method, which is transportable, could be interesting for this purpose. Materials and Methods:The Swiss Evaluation of the Methods of Measurement of Osteoporotic Fracture Risk (SEMOF) study is a multicenter cohort study, which compared three QUSs for the assessment of hip fracture risk in a sample of 7609 elderly ambulatory women Ն70 years of age. Two QUSs measured the heel (Achilles+; GE-Lunar and Sahara; Hologic), and one measured the heel (DBM Sonic 1200; IGEA). The Cox proportional hazards regression was used to estimate the hazard of the first hip fracture, adjusted for age, BMI, and center, and the area under the ROC curves were calculated to compare the devices and their parameters. Results: From the 7609 women who were included in the study, 7062 women 75.2 ± 3.1 (SD) years of age were prospectively followed for 2.9 ± 0.8 years. Eighty women reported a hip fracture. A decrease by 1 SD of the QUS variables corresponded to an increase of the hip fracture risk from 2.3 (95% CI, 1.7, 3.1) to 2.6 (95% CI, 1.9, 3.4) for the three variables of Achilles+ and from 2.2 (95% CI, 1.7, 3.0) to 2.4 (95% CI, 1.8, 3.2) for the three variables of Sahara. Risk gradients did not differ significantly among the variables of the two heel QUS devices. On the other hand, the phalanges QUS (DBM Sonic 1200) was not predictive of hip fracture risk, with an adjusted hazard risk of 1.2 (95% CI, 0.9, 1.5), even after reanalysis of the digitalized data and using different cut-off levels (1700 or 1570 m/s). Conclusions: In this elderly women population, heel QUS devices were both predictive of hip fracture risk, whereas the phalanges QUS device was not.
Objective: To investigate the long-term effects of nasal continuous positive airway pressure (CPAP) ventilation in patients with obstructive sleep apnea syndrome (OSAS) on body composition (BC) and IGF1. Design: Observational study. Subjects: Seventy-eight (11 females and 67 males) OSAS patients who were compliant with CPAP (age 51G1.1 years) participated in the study. We assessed body mass index (BMI), total body mass (TBM), total body fat (TBF; kg) and lean body mass (LBM; kg), abdominal subcutaneous (SC) and visceral (V) fat (cm 2 ), and waist circumference (WC; cm) by magnetic resonance imaging, and IGF1 (ng/ml) before and after 7.8G1.3 months of CPAP use of an average of 5.9G1.2 h. Results: Women had a higher BMI, WC; TBM, TBF, and more SC fat. Men had a higher LBM and more V fat. CPAP increased WC (C2.8G9.6 cm, PZ0.02) and LBM (2.2G0.5 kg, PZ0.006), but not IGF1. In men, CPAP increased BMI (0.5G0.2 kg/m 2 , PZ0.02), WC (1.7G6.9 cm, PZ0.002), TBM (1.7G0.4 kg, PZ0.0001), LBM (1.5G0.4 kg, PZ0.0003), SC fat (12.9G5.1 cm 2 , PZ0.02), and IGF1 (13.6G4.2 ng/ml, PZ0.002). Compliance with CPAP increased LBM in men aged !60 years, but not in those aged O60 years, and IGF1 increased in men aged 40-60 years only. Conclusions: Long-term CPAP increased LBM in both sexes and IGF1 in men, while fat mass remained unchanged, suggesting a sexually dimorphic response of IGF1 to CPAP. The role of the GH axis activity and age to this response is unclear. The metabolic consequences of changes in LBM are still to be determined. Future studies on the effects of CPAP on BC should include LBM as an outcome.
Bone ultrasound measures (QUSs) can assess fracture risk in the elderly. We compared three QUSs and their association with nonvertebral fracture history in 7562 Swiss women 70 -80 years of age. The association between nonvertebral fracture was higher for heel than phalangeal QUS.Introduction: Because of the high morbidity and mortality associated with osteoporotic fractures, it is essential to detect subjects at risk for such fractures with screening methods. Because quantitative bone ultrasound (QUS) discriminated subjects with osteoporotic fractures from controls in several cross-sectional studies and predicted fractures in prospective studies, QUS could be more practical than DXA for screening. Material and Methods:This cross-sectional and retrospective multicenter (10 centers) study was performed to compare three QUSs (two heel ultrasounds: Achillesϩ [GE-Lunar] and Sahara [Hologic]; the phalanges: ultrasound DBM sonic 1200 [IGEA]) for determining by logistic regression nonvertebral fracture odds ratio (OR) in a sample of 7562 Swiss women, 75.3 Ϯ 3.1 years of age. The two heel QUSs measured the broadband ultrasound attenuation (BUA) and the speed of sound (SOS). In addition, Achillesϩ calculated the stiffness index (SI) and the Sahara calculated the quantitative ultrasound index (QUI) from BUA and SOS. The DBM sonic 1200 measured the amplitude-dependent SOS (AD-SOS). Results: Eighty-six women had a history of atraumatic hip fracture after the age of 50, 1594 had a history of forearm fracture, and 2016 had other nonvertebral fractures. No fracture history was reported by 3866 women. Discrimination for hip fracture was higher than for the other nonvertebral fractures. The two heel QUSs had a significantly higher discrimination power than the QUSs of the phalanges, with standardized ORs, adjusted for age and body mass index, ranging from 2.1 to 2.7 (95% CI ϭ 1.6, 3.5) compared with 1.4 (95% CI ϭ 1.1, 1.7) for the AD-SOS of DBM sonic 1200. Conclusion: This study showed a high association between heel QUS and hip fracture history in elderly Swiss women. This could justify integration of QUS among screening strategies for identifying elderly women at risk for osteoporotic fractures.
Aims:To assess the incidence of voluntary stopping of eating and drinking in long-term care and to gain insights into the attitudes of long-term care nurses about the voluntary stopping of eating and drinking. Design: A cross-sectional studyMethods: Heads of Swiss nursing homes (535; 34%) answered the Online-Survey between June and October 2017, which was evaluated using descriptive data analysis. Results:The incidence of patients who died in Swiss nursing homes by voluntarily stopping eating and drinking is 1.7% and 67.5% of participants consider this phenomenon highly relevant in their daily work. Most participants (64.2%) rate voluntary stopping of eating and drinking as a natural death accompanied by health professionals and patients are also granted the right to care (91.9%). This phenomenon is expected by the participants less at a young age and more in old age. Conclusion:Participants' overall views on the voluntary stopping of eating and drinking are very positive, whereas it is assumed that voluntary stopping of eating and drinking is a phenomenon of old age. Professionals still lack sufficient knowledge about this phenomenon, which could be clarified through training.
